Generation NXT - NXT recap for September 26, 2023

Butch beats Joe Coffey after Coffey dives into the side of the ring steps to win the Global Heritage Invitational and face Noam Dar for the NXT Heritage Cup at No Mercy.



Backstage, McKenzie Mitchell interviews "Dirty" Dominik Mysterio, who says he has a free Saturday only to find out he is defending the North American title against the winner of Axiom vs. Tyler Bate vs. Dragon Lee later tonight at No Mercy.

We hear from Tony D'Angelo and Channing "Stacks" Lorenzo, who are focused on the family dinner as well as their next title defense when Humberto Carrillo and Angel Garza, who make it known they want the NXT tag team titles.

Trick Williams beats Joe Gacy.



After the match, Kelly Kincaid interviews Trick Williams in the ring. Trick says it feels good to get the win, and says that while Ilja Dragunov hits hard, he would be a fool to bet against Carmelo Hayes retaining his championship. Trick Williams then says that with Carmelo holding his own championship, it is time to get one himself.

Backstage, McKenzie Mitchell interviews Blair Davenport, who calls Gigi Dolin "pathetic" and says that the difference between them is that when she attacks people, they don't get back up, and that Gigi will find this out tonight.

Backstage, Andre Chase and Duke Hudson are met by Jacy Jayne. Jacy Jayne brings out Thea Hail, who shows up with a new look. Duke Hudson has to get Andre Chase to hold back on his opinion of Thea's clothes before Thea gets ready for her match with Dani Palmer later tonight.



Baron Corbin beats Josh Briggs with a cheap shot followed by End of Days. After the match, Baron Corbin says that he will find out if Bron Breakker barks or bites at No Mercy before teling him he has seen his end of days. Bron gets in the ring and punches Corbin in the face, starting a brawl that security and officials quickly have to break up.



Trick Williams is seen entering Shawn Michaels' office.

We see a video package for Tiffany Stratton vs. Becky Lynch in an Extreme Rules Match for the NXT Women's Championship at No Mercy.



Bronco Nima and Lucien Price - now known as "Out The Mud" - beat Hank Walker and Tank Ledger after Scrypts grabs Tank Ledger in the corner, allowing Bronco and Lucien to gang up on Hank and double-team Tank for the win.



Backstage, Blair Davenport turns the lights out and attacks Gigi Dolin in the locker room.

Humberto Garcia and Angel Garza have dinner with Tony D'Angelo and Channing "Stacks" Lorenzo when The Creed Brothers also join in. In the middle of this, D'Angelo and Stacks find out about the tattoos that Humberto and Angel have in tribute to their grandfather.

Axiom and Tyler Bate talk about the Triple Threat Match that they have tonight. Trick Williams shows up and says that he is now in the Triple Threat Match, making it a Fatal 4-Way.

Eddy Thorpe beats Dijak in a Strap Match. After the match, Dijak hits Eddy Thorpe with Feast Your Eyes before superkicking him into the Tree of Woe position in the corner. He then hogties Thorpe's legs together with the leather strap before whipping Thorpe with a leather belt until referees stop him.



Blair Davenport butts in on commentary, then tells Gigi Dolin to remember how she feels right now next time she wants to play her game, because next time will be far worse.

Thea Hail beats Dani Palmer with the Kimura Lock.



Backstage, Trick Williams talks with Carmelo Hayes regarding his chance for a shot at the North American Championship, but Carmelo is too pre-occupied with his contract signing with Ilja Dragunov later tonight.

Baron Corbin is attacked by Bron Breakker again backstage.

Trick Williams beats Axiom, Tyler Bate and Dragon Lee in a Fatal 4-Way to face "Dirty" Dominik Mysterio for the NXT North American Championship after headbutting Dragon Lee, accidentally backing into Tyler Bate and knocking him off the ring apron after hitting the headbutt and falling into Axiom for the win.



Out The Mud (Bronco Nima and Lucien Price) show up late for Tony D'Angelo and Channing "Stacks" Lorenzo. Everyone argues over who D'Angelo and Stacks will defend the NXT tag tiles against. D'Angelo calls for some back-up, then D'Angelo says he wants to see all the teams at No Mercy. Everyone toasts on it.



Backstage, McKenzie Mitchell interviews Dominik Mysterio, who says that he will whup Trick Williams before making it known that he runs NXT that he will destroy Trick like he destroyed Dragon Lee. Dragon Lee then jumps Dominik from behind.

We see footage of somebody changing channels on a CRT television until stopping at WCW Saturday Night.

Ilja Dragunov and Carmelo Hayes have a contract signing for their match for the NXT Championship at No Mercy. Carmelo tells Dragunov that there is nothing left to talk about, but Dragunov tells Carmelo that he is the wrong person at the wrong time and the wrong man for the NXT Championship. Carmelo says he did not plan for The Great American Bash to go the way that he did, and that he will walk into No Mercy knowing that he will beat Dragunov, and Dragunov mentions that Carmelo struggles outside of his comfrot zone with his confidence and will know unbearable pain. Carmelo says the real unbearable pain is Dragunov believing his own hype, but Dragon asks Carmelo what will happen if Carmelo gives his best and it is not enough. Carmelo says being NXT Champion is about being undeniable and being "Him," and that he wants Dragunov to realize that he is unlike those he has beaten before - including Trick Williams, whose name he accidentally blurts out - and that they will get rid of those "what ifs." Dragunov signs the contract, then slams it down on the table in front of Carmelo and tells him that he will do nothing because he cannot do nothing. He says that he will push Carmelo to his limits, and that when he becomes NXT Championship, Carmelo's dynasty will fall. Carmelo signs the contract. Carmelo then tells Dragunov that the NXT Championship is bigger than both of them and that while Dragunov can carry the NXT Championship and its responsibilities, he cannot do it better than he can. Afterwards, it is announced that Dragon Lee will be the special guest referee for Trick Williams vs. "Dirty" Dominik Mysterio for the North American Championship, then it is revealed that Bron Breakker and Carmelo Hayes are fighting outside of the building. Bron goes for a Spear, but Corbin dodges and Bron hits the car door. This leads to Corbin choke slamming Bron on top of the car, but Bron gets back up. Corbin makes his way into the arena, but Bron fallows him and breaks through the wall into Shawn Michaels' office.
